Question
- which of the following is an example of unbalanced forces? a) a book resting on a desk b) two students pulling a rope with equal force in opposite directions c) a soccer ball rolling after being kicked d) a magnet stuck to a refrigerator
Brief Explanations
- Option a: A book resting on a desk has balanced forces (gravity and normal force are equal and opposite), so it's not unbalanced.
- Option b: Two students pulling a rope with equal force in opposite directions result in balanced forces (net force is zero), so it's not unbalanced.
- Option c: A soccer ball rolling after being kicked has unbalanced forces because the force from the kick is no longer balanced by an equal opposing force, causing it to accelerate (change velocity) as it rolls (friction also acts, but overall net force is not zero).
- Option d: A magnet stuck to a refrigerator has balanced forces (magnetic force and the force of gravity/normal force balance), so it's not unbalanced.
